PROJECT STAGES

Responsive Image and Text Layout
Stage 1: Induction

INDUCTION

Free consultation to discuss the manufacturing process and project options.

Initial Meeting


We start by learning about your brand, product goals, target audience, and regulatory requirements. This ensures that we are fully aligned with your vision when developing a product to reflect your brand’s identity and marketing position.

Budgeting & Feasibility


One of the most critical points to define at the outset is a project budget range. This way we can ensure expectations are able to be met when discussing the available packaging and formulation options with the specific product type, size, and order quantities in mind.

Project Definition


Packaging: The type, size, minimum order quantity, lead times, and pricing for all packaging components are defined and samples are obtained for approval.

Order Quantity: We calculate the labor costs based on the order quantity. Higher order volumes will result in a lower labor cost per unit.

Formulation: The specific ingredient requirements are outlined to ensure regulatory alignment. Packaging should be finalized before the formulation to ensure compatibility and budgeting accuracy.

R&D Payment


An R&D payment per formulation is collected to cover labor, materials, and shipping for prototypes. This fee is credited towards your initial production order and ranges from $500 to $1,000 based on complexity.

Responsive Image and Text Layout
Stage 2: R&D

R&D

The R&D lab fee is required for each formulation to begin work on the project. Fee will be applied to initial MOQ order.

Formulation


One of our R&D Chemists will take the Formulation Request Form submitted and begin development of the formulation while taking into consideration all the requirements provided.

Prototype Samples


Initial formulation prototype samples are produced typically within 2-4 weeks of receiving the R&D Payment and Formulation Request Form depending on material availability / sourcing needs. Additional rounds of samples for adjustments are typically processed within 1-2 weeks. Most projects require between 1-3 rounds of samples.

Sample Approval


Once the formulation has met all feel, smell, application, and performance targets a conditional sample approval is provided at which time an ingredient list is generated for final review and approval.

Pricing


Once the formulation has been approved and packaging has been defined/quoted we will have all our costs at which time we can provide a quote for the final product. This quote will be good for 30 days and will remain in place so long as the material costs remain constant.

Responsive Image and Text Layout
Stage 3: Registration

REGISTRATION

Some countries will require registration of products before manufacturing begins

Artwork


A printing die line for the packaging will be provided for the client to generate artwork on and return for review. Artwork for products sold in the USA must adhere to FDA labeling guidelines.

Artwork Approval


Once artwork is submitted to the printer, the printer will provide a digital .pdf proof that will need to be signed off on and approved by the client. Physical proofs can be requested from the printer, but they cost an additional fee that will be passed on and billed for.

Registration


We can assist with any documentation required for the registration of products along with any additional testing needed. All 3rd party tests for custom formulations will be billed to the client, i.e. Stability & Shelf Life Testing, Preservative Efficacy Testing (PET), Toxicological Risk Assessment (TRA), Microbiological Testing, etc.

50% Order Deposit


We require a 50% deposit with the Purchase Order to start the production process.

Responsive Image and Text Layout
Stage 4: Manufacturing

MANUFACTURING

The production process begins with a minimum order quantity that is based on the product type and size.

Procurement


Raw materials and packaging are procured for the order.

Manufacturing


Once all materials are in-house, the order is scheduled, picked, batched, filled, QC tested, and prepared for shipment.

Final Payment


Once the order is ready, a final invoice will be generated, and the final payment will be required to release the shipment.

Product Release


A packing list will be made available along with the weights and dimensions of the shipment for the client to schedule a pickup.

Advanced Mfg Capabilities

Our production department contains 14 high-speed filling lines for product sizes ranging from 0.5oz to 32oz and can service all types of bottles, tubes, vials, sachets, hot-pour jars/sticks, display box pack outs, labeling, graphic steam-shrink sleeving and more.

Our compounding department is equipped with 16 stainless steel, jacketed mixing tanks ranging from 20 to 2,000 gallons for full production scalability.
